If you find yourself company where your electricity bills are already too much of a burden, there are things that you can do. You can try and assess you current billing statement and see if you can find any areas where you can save. Look for any charges that should not be there, errors that are making your bill higher. Then, you can compare electricity prices in your area. Switch to a different company if you need to. This is the problem with some.  They are hesitant to transfer to a different company because they think it will be an inconvenience. That is not true at all. You can make the switch without any downtime on your part.

Lastly, if you care a lot with the environment, find a company that uses renewable energy. Or you can make your home sustainable to electricity. You might have to spend money because those solar panels don't come cheap but think about what you can save in the long run.
